Wednesday, April 25, 2012

Where should you live?

Apparently the graphic is a little messed up. My rankings are:
1. Canada
2. Sweden
3. Australia
4. New Zealand
5. Norway

Check it out and create your own! I was definitely surprised that Germany and Austria were both ranked lower than the US, which came in at #11.

No comments:

Post a Comment